Louis was born in Kiltimagh, Co Mayo, in 1952 to parents Maureen and Frank Walsh and is one of seven siblings. In the early 90s, Louis wanted to kickstart his career in the music industry and moved to Dublin. He had the goal of creating an Irish version of the iconic band Take That - which consisted of Gary Barlow, Howard Donald, Mark Owen, Robbie Williams and Jason Orange.

He soon started advertising the open auditions and ended up with Keith Duffy, Michael Graham, Stephen Gately, Shane Lynch and Ronan Keating together as Boyzone. He managed the group to international success with 16 top-three singles, six of which were number-one, and four number-one albums. The band sold more than 20 million copies worldwide.

When Ronan stepped back from Boyzone, Louis continued to manage his career. It wasn't the only band Louis created as he soon formed Westlife - which Ronan co-managed with Louis for the first few albums. In 2001, Louis started his television work in the Irish version of Popstars. He went on to become a judge on UK ITV's Popstars: The Rivals before appearing in the shows we know him from.

Along with Boyzone, he managed Bellefire, Six, Girls Aloud, Union J and Myles and Connor. Away from music management and TV, Louis has been quiet about his love life and refuses to talk about his relationships. From what we know, the star has never been married.

In an interview with the Sunday Times in 2013, Louis was asked about his love life and said: “I can't... Don't go there. I can't. I think your private life is your private life... I'm happy.”
